Firewall Specifications
Firewall specifications are individual to your requirements – just as cold rooms are designed to suit your specific project and processes, firewalls are designed to your specifications. There are two main types of panel systems: fire resistant and fire rated.
Fire resistant panels are commonly used to building fire resistant cold rooms – these panels are manufactured from insulated panels with a fire resistant ‘skin’. These panels must be built in accordance with manufacturer specifications and are installed different to a ‘standard’ cold room.
Fire rated panels, used to build dividing walls and fire rated boxes, are composite panels made from high density, non-combustible stone wool core between pre-finished steel.
The panel system selected will impact the time they are resistant to fire – but firewalls can be rated from 30 minutes to 4 hours for walls and ceilings dependent on your requirements.
When selecting the specifications for firewalls, it’s important to consider the implications of your insurer’s requirements and if there are building regulations to adhere to. Different firewalls have different classifications for insurance, and you may require very specific requirements for building regs.
